logo

Output 07d653a02db9b43d046c771251b5253e1684a845c563acf59be56331aef8ef94:1

value
31879609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d036b74a4b2431f4f96376365a10c9186d9618c OP_EQUAL
address
3EYdJCZXS14ohnwAHD1KD1pYBwmXByjdYB
transaction
07d653a02db9b43d046c771251b5253e1684a845c563acf59be56331aef8ef94